VERTICAL TERMINATION SYSTEMS (ROOF)

See Figure 20 on Page 12 and Figures 28-

32 on Pages 15 and 16 and their associated

Vertical Vent Tables which illustrate the various

vertical venting configurations that are possible

for use with these appliances.

Secure Vent pipe

applications are shown in these Figures;

Secure

Flex pipe may also be used. A Vertical Vent

Table summarizes each system’s minimum and

maximum vertical and horizontal length values

that can be used to design and install the vent

components in a variety of applications.

Both these vertical vent systems terminate

through the roof. The minimum vent height

above the roof and/or adjacent walls is speci-

fied in ANSI Z223.1-(latest edition) (In Canada,

the current CAN-1 B149 installation code) by

major building codes. Always consult your lo-

cal codes for specific requirements. A general

guide to follow is the Gas Vent Rule (refer to

Figure 5 on Page 5 ).

Vertical (Straight) Installation

Determine the number of straight vent sections

required. 4-1/2" (114 mm), 10-1/2" (267 mm),

22-1/2" (572 mm), 34-1/2" (876 mm) and 46-

1/2" (1181 mm) net section lengths are available

(see

Table 11 and Page 31 - Item 3). Plan the

vent lengths so that a joint does not occur at

the intersection of ceiling or roof joists. Refer

to the Vent Section Length Chart.
